A person has died following a fire north of Lindsay, Ont., on Thursday afternoon.
City of Kawartha Lakes OPP and other investigators remained on the scene Friday along Snug Harbour Road.
They were focusing on the marina area.
OPP say the blaze was extinguished by fire rescue before officers arrived.
On Friday morning OPP confirmed one person died as a result of the fire.
No details have been provided about the victim.
The Office of the Fire Marshal was also on scene.
The cause of the fire remains under investigation.
